Label Text Redrum:
“On October 30, 1974, Stephen King and his wife stayed alone at the Stanley Hotel where the eerie atmosphere and empty corridors left a haunting impression. That night, a vivid nightmare of his son being chased through the halls inspired King to write The Shining. Redrum amber ale I perfectly balanced with toasty malt, herbal & citrus hops & a dry finish.”

About Left Hand Brewing Company:
Left Hand Brewing Company, founded in Longmont, Colorado, is one of the original pioneers in craft brewing. From a humble homebrew kit beginning to becoming one of the top 50 craft breweries in the U.S., Left Hand has continued to grow and innovate throughout our 30+ year history. Famous for our Nitro series, Left Hand launched America’s original Nitro bottle with our flagship Milk Stout Nitro and the first production run of U.S.- made Nitro widget cans. We’re proud to be one of the most honored and recognized breweries in Colorado with 31 Great American Beer Festival medals,11 World Beer Cup awards and nine European Beer Star awards. It all started with a humble homebrew kit and a desire to elevate the craft beer scene in the U.S.
Growing up in an Air Force family, Left Hand Founder Eric Wallace traveled the globe from a young age and continued his journey of exploration as an adult during his own time in the Air Force. Inspired by the rich, diverse beer styles he encountered in Europe and frustrated by the lack of options back home, Eric set out to brew the kind of beer he craved. What began as a hobby soon turned into a passion, and in September 1993, Left Hand Brewing was born in Longmont, Colorado.
